Transaction 15c9872fa68597b71ef0e4a023f931025aa1863a56d05135e36d8d97cf1cc9a6

2 Input
2 Outputs
  • 15c9872fa68597b71ef0e4a023f931025aa1863a56d05135e36d8d97cf1cc9a6:0
  • value  40323746
    address  bc1qcwrge6nt74s79e2mr6d8fh64pc5ytdw3vcf96dqch8nr3az5klfshypqzd
  • 15c9872fa68597b71ef0e4a023f931025aa1863a56d05135e36d8d97cf1cc9a6:1
  • value  122700000
    address  1DHgR4dVC3uZh5ouDWzyqeuQpEYQEmon81